Rochdale 1 Shrews 1

Rochdale 1 Shrews 1Shrewsbury Town finished the season in 18th place - eight points clear of the relegation zone - as they grabbed an away point at Rochdale.

A first-half header from Asa Hall saw the Shrews take the lead against a Rochdale side chasing a place in the League Two play-offs.
Rochdale equalised after the break when Chris Dagnall capitalised on an error from Shrews keeper Scott Bevan.

Rochdale ended in fifth place and face Darlington in the play-off semi-finals.
